You should probably install the update RPMs from the command line anyway, since they require the --replacepkgs option. I've heard of people having problems with the System Update feature, and would rather not risk it (though I haven't personally had any problems).

http://www.chrouch.com/e-smith/rpm-howto.html shows how to install RPMs by copying them to an ibay. You can also use WinSCP2 (http://winscp.vse.cz/) to directly copy the files to a directory on the server. Then just log in as root, switch to that directory, and run the commands listed in the README.
